DUBLIN CITY TAKE HOME THE SPOILS IN T20 OPENER

It was a 5 wicket victory for Dublin City in this afternoon’s first fixture in College Park, as a half-century from David Vincent wasn’t enough to propel Dublin University to a winning total.

Having won the toss home skipper Gavin Hoey decided to make first use of a slow College Park wicket, and Vincent was the only man in the top 6 who could consistently find himself able to get the pace of the wicket enough to turn over the strike.

After a pair of early wickets for Cillian McDonnell were backed up with one for each of Andy Doheny and Danny Forkin, Dublin University were on the back foot and needed to rebuild, thankfully from their point of view a 50 partnership between Vincent and Mikey O’Reilly did just that. Seeing them eventually reach a total of 107/7 in their 20 overs.

Ashil Prakash fell early in the chase bowled by O’Reilly for just 4, with a 64 run partnership between Swapnil Modgil and Hedayat Khogiani brought the score to 73 before the fall of the next wicket. Two quick wickets for Jamie Forbes saw Modgil and Philippe le Roux dismissed, before Will Barker dismissed Khogiani for 41.

Pembroke men Dan Murray (11*) and Noah Smith (9*) however ensured the win was secured without too much drama however, knocking off the final 20 runs to see them to a 6 wicket win.
